SQL Server PPT教程:掌握事务管理与T-SQL编程
需积分: 16 112 浏览量
更新于2024-07-12
收藏 14.58MB PPT 举报
本资源主要讲解如何在SQL Server环境下创建事务,这是数据库管理系统(DBMS)中的核心概念,对于理解和管理数据一致性至关重要。SQL Server提供了T-SQL(Transact-SQL)语言来处理事务,包括开始(BEGIN TRANSACTION)、提交(COMMIT TRANSACTION)和回滚(ROLLBACK TRANSACTION)三种基本操作。
在数据库原理与应用的学习中,课程涵盖了SQL Server 2005的全面内容,从安装与管理器、数据库管理到存储过程、触发器等多个方面。课程评估方式包括考勤、课堂测验、实践操作和期末考试,强调理论与实践相结合。
第一部分介绍了SQL Server 2005的安装和管理,包括数据库的概念、关系数据库模型、以及SQL Server的基本使用,如启动服务器。这部分强调了数据库在日常生活和商业场景中的广泛应用,如超市收银、火车售票、通信记录查询等,突出了数据库作为存储和检索大量数据的核心工具。
数据库的优点被重点阐述,如存储容量大、数据一致性、共享性和安全性,以及数据分析和挖掘能力。此外,还介绍了数据库的基本组成部分,如数据、数据库本身、数据库管理系统,以及数据库管理员的角色。数据库系统作为一个整体,包括数据库、DBMS和相关硬件与应用程序,由数据库管理员进行统一管理和维护,确保数据的安全和完整性。
在具体操作层面,T-SQL编程是关键技能之一,尤其是在处理事务时,掌握BEGIN TRANSACTION语句开启事务,COMMIT TRANSACTION用于保存更改,而ROLLBACK TRANSACTION则用于在遇到错误时撤销操作,确保数据的原子性。这些命令在数据库事务处理中起到至关重要的作用,是确保数据操作正确性和可靠性的基石。
这个资源深入浅出地讲解了如何在SQL Server中创建事务,以及数据库管理的各个方面,对于学习数据库原理和SQL Server技术的同学来说,是一份实用且全面的学习资料。
130 浏览量
2023-02-27 上传
236 浏览量
2022-06-03 上传
2022-06-05 上传
2022-11-13 上传
2022-06-05 上传
2022-06-16 上传
2023-03-25 上传
花香九月
- 粉丝: 29
- 资源: 2万+
最新资源
- zabaatLib:vvolfster的QML Qt UI和应用程序库
- proposal-array-equality:确定数组相等
- SQLite v3.28.0
- jQuery css3图标动画鼠标滑过图标旋转动画特效
- vecel-antenna
- MP3格式万能转换器任何音频均可自由切换格式
- 黑马瑞吉外卖源码及工程项目全套
- Foodfy-database:Persistindo dados daaplicaçãoFoodfy
- 展示::framed_picture:课程中展示的最佳学生作品展示
- Open Virtual Reality 'L'-开源
- 影响matlab速度的代码-table-testing:表达式矩阵文件格式的要求,示例和测试
- 行业文档-设计装置-饲料用缓释型复方甜菊糖微囊的制备方法.zip
- RedisSubscribeServer.zip
- Wireshark-win32-1.8.4
- C# winform设计 钉钉 微信 二维码 扫码登录登录客户端 源码文件 CS架构
- Martin_Barroso_P2:RISCV Multiciclo con UART para corrercódigo阶乘